International Developers Pack
IDIP a new safe guard which allows you to see financial reports, legal documentation & ownership details of the developer and development.
IDIP (International Developer Information Pack) has been designed to protect the agent and investor, against false information being provided by any particular developer or about a development. Similar to the Home Information Pack schemes which have been launched in the UK, IDIP has a responsibility to make sure the investment really does turn out to be a dream property investment. Saving all the heartache and costs involved in trying to retrieve what is sometimes a very messy, costly and sole destroying scenario.
full company search will be carried out, going into Directors, share holders, state of the company. Management contracts, rental programmes guarantees, rental laws. Construction issues, political circumstances, etc the lawyers will request information from the developer, these to include references and follow these up, they will look into any inconsistencies between the information provided and the information on the company search and will request missing documentation The lawyers will give a full report on their findings and analyse the developer and any of the documentation provided.
